Cribbing might also be associated with feeding, stabling and management practices, including feeding high quantities of concentrate, low-forage diets, and limiting horses' turnout, grazing and/or opportunities to socialize with other horses. Whether it is called cribbing, crib biting, wind sucking, or aerophagia, this is an obsessive-compulsive habit in horses that is likely caused by boredom, stress, or possibly stomach acidity that can lead to equine ulcers. Cribbing muzzles appear similar to grazing muzzles, but most use metal bars across the bottom to allow the horse full access to eating and drinking while stopping him from biting onto a horizontal surface to crib. Dr. Houpt says these popular neck collars do seem to work, but "you have to make it so tight that often the horse develops lesions." "I would generally say, unless the horse colics recurrently, that it's better to allow him to crib than to prevent it through collars or surgery," says Dr. Mills. Some horses are naturally more anxious and stress prone, and Dr. Mills says that could be a predisposition for cribbing. Studies by other teams of researchers, including several to which Auburn University's McCall has contributed, also link gastric ulcers with cribbers and show a lower gastric pH in cribbing horses, indicating they have a more acidic gastric environment. Crib-biting appears to be an attempt by horses to lessen the discomfort caused by ulcers; cribbing stimulates the flow of saliva, which reduces the acidity associated with concentrate feeding.
